Description
The Ultrasonic Homogenizer YR05832 // YR05836 is a cutting-edge ultrasonic processor designed for precision and reliability across diverse scientific and industrial settings. Utilizing ultrasonic cavitation technology, this device effectively processes substances in liquids, making it ideal for applications involving cell disruption, nanostructured material dispersion, emulsification, and chemical reaction acceleration. Its versatility is showcased by its use in biochemistry, microbiology, medicinal chemistry, and more, ensuring superior performance and consistency for both small and large sample volumes.

Field Use
This ultrasonic homogenizer serves as an essential tool in both biomedical and chemical research laboratories as well as industrial production environments. In biotechnology, it is widely used for cell disruption and protein extraction, and in the chemical industry, it aids in reaction acceleration and material homogenization. Additionally, it plays a crucial role in vaccine preparation and viral culture processing.

Technical Specifications
Models | YR05832 | YR05833 | YR05834 |
Ultrasonic Frequency(KHZ) | 20-25 | ||
Maximum Power(W) | 650 | 900 | 1000 |
Optional Variable Amplitude Lever(φ) mm | 2,3,6,10,12 | 2,3,6,10,12,15 | 2,3,8,10,12,15 |
Included with | 6 | 10 | 15 |
Capacity | 0.2-500 | 0.2-600 | 0.2-800 |
Electricity Supply (V) | 220/110 | ||
Temperature Control | NO | YES | NO |
Models | YR05835 | YR05836 |
Ultrasonic Frequency(KHZ) | 20-25 | |
Maximum Power(W) | 1200 | 1800 |
Optional Variable Amplitude Lever(φ) mm | 10,15,22,25 | 10,15,22,25,28 |
Included with | 22 | 25 |
Capacity | 20-1000 | 20-1200 |
Electricity Supply (V) | 220/110 | |
Temperature Control | YES |
